The Ultra Fine Copper Powder is a specialized form of copper material characterized by its extremely small particle size, typically ranging from a few nanometers to several micrometers. It possesses outstanding electrical and thermal conductivity, excellent corrosion resistance, and high surface activity, making it an essential raw material in advanced industrial and technological applications. The uniformity, purity, and fine granularity of ultra fine copper powder enable its use in industries such as electronics, metallurgy, chemical processing, and additive manufacturing.

In the electronics industry, ultra fine copper powder is widely used for producing conductive pastes, coatings, and inks that are essential for printed circuit boards (PCBs), semiconductors, and other microelectronic components. Its superior conductivity and fine particle size ensure efficient current flow, precise circuit patterning, and high performance in miniaturized electronic devices. With the growing demand for compact and energy-efficient electronic products, ultra fine copper powder has become increasingly vital in developing next-generation electrical and electronic systems.

In powder metallurgy and 3D printing, ultra fine copper powder is used to manufacture complex metal parts with excellent mechanical strength and thermal properties. Industries such as aerospace, automotive, and defense utilize ultra fine copper powder to produce components that require high heat dissipation and reliability, such as heat exchangers, engine parts, and conductive tools.

The chemical and industrial sectors also benefit from the use of ultra fine copper powder as a catalyst and additive. It plays a crucial role in chemical reactions such as hydrogenation, reduction, and oxidation due to its high reactivity and surface area. Additionally, it is used in coatings, lubricants, and antibacterial materials, taking advantage of copper’s natural antimicrobial properties. Its application in water purification systems and antifouling coatings further showcases its versatility and environmental significance.

The global ultra fine copper powder market is witnessing significant growth, driven by rapid industrialization, expansion of the electronics sector, and increasing adoption of additive manufacturing technologies. Ongoing research focuses on improving production methods like chemical reduction, electrolysis, and gas atomization to achieve higher purity, uniformity, and environmental sustainability.
